垃圾评论一直都是困扰很多WordPress站长的一个问题,虽然可以用一些防范手段来阻止这些垃圾评论,但还是会有一些漏网之鱼。
那么当你的网站已经存在成千上万的待审评论(垃圾评论)时,你该怎么快速删除它们?
方法1:手动操作
在评论管理界面,点击右上角的“显示选项”,将每页项目数调整大一些,比如100,然后我们切换到“待审”选项卡,就可以全新,然后通过“批量操作”去移至回收站,或设为垃圾评论,再进行永久删除。
这个方法对于一千以内的垃圾评论来说,还是可以接受的,但是,如果已经有数千或上万,那操作起来也是很累人的。如果是这个情况,那可以借助下面的方式。
方法2:通过SQL命令操作
如果你通过phpMyAdmin这样的数据库面板访问数据库,那也可以执行SQL命令来批量删除。如果你不熟悉phpMyAdmin操作,可以看一下phpMyAdmin教程之使用SQL查询语句修改数据库信息
注意:直接操作数据库非常危险,请必须确保你自己会必要的操作,并且操作前请一定一定一定备份数据库!!!
请根据自己的需要选择下面的SQL命令,每个命令单独执行:
- // 删除所有待审评论
- delete * from wp_comments WHERE comment_approved='0';
- // 删除所有垃圾评论
- delete * from wp_comments WHERE comment_approved='spam';
- // 删除所有回收站的评论
- delete * from wp_comments WHERE comment_approved='trash';
需要根据自己的数据库前缀,修改 wp_comments
这个表的 wp_
前缀为你自己的前缀。
以上两种方法供大家食用。